Robert Ray DeVries, 83, entered into eternal rest on Wednesday, December 25, 2024, at Sanford USD Medical Center in Sioux Falls, SD. Funeral Services will be held at 11:00 AM, Tuesday, December 31st at Peace Lutheran Church (5509 W. 41st St., Sioux Falls). The family will greet friends for visitation from 4:00 - 6:00 PM, Monday, December 30, 2024, at Miller Funeral Home's Westside Chapel (6200 W. 41st St., Sioux Falls).
Robert was born on August 1st, 1941 in Orange City, IA to Charles and Geraldine (Kleinhesselink) DeVries. He graduated from Beaver Creek High School in 1959. During high school, he was active in football, the yearbook annual staff, camera club, aviation club, and gun club. Following high school, he served in the US Army Reserve. Robert married the love of his life, Muriel Hagena, on July 19, 1966, at the Delaware Reformed Church of Lennox.
Robert and Muriel began their life together in Sioux Falls. Their journey of faith included Delaware Reformed Church, Sunnycrest United Methodist Church, and Chancellor Reformed Church. After living in Sioux Falls for many years, they relocated their family to rural Chancellor in 1989 until they moved back to Sioux Falls in 2008. Robert farmed near Chancellor for over 20 years. He also spent his working years employed by John Morrell Meat Packing Plant, Civil Defense Rescue Squad, Western Mall Security, Argus Leader, and Cimpl Packing Company.
Over the years, Robert enjoyed hunting, fishing, camping, and attending the many events of his seven grandchildren.
Grateful for sharing his life are his daughters, Tanya DeVries (David Corey) of Lenexa, KS, Tara (Patrick) Foley and their children, Alex, Aidan, and Anna of Sioux Falls, SD, Tandis (Gregory) Hoffman and their children, Grayson and Gabrielle of Rapid City, SD, Treva (Eric) Petersen and their children, Lauren and Laine of Hurley, SD; sister, Phyllis (Jay) Lunstra; sister-in-law, Pat DeVries; and a host of other relatives and friends.
Robert was preceded in death by his loving wife, Muriel DeVries; brother, Dave DeVries; and parents, Charles and Geraldine DeVries.
